Five Star Schools

The Five Star School Award was created by the Commissioner's Community Involvement Council and is presented annually to those schools that have shown evidence of exemplary community involvement. In order to earn Five STAR School recognition, a school must show documentation that it has achieved 100% of the established criteria in the categories of:

 

· Business Partnerships
· Family Involvement
· Volunteerism
· Student Community Service
· School Advisory Councils

 

Guidelines are avaliable through the district's Coordinator of Community Involvement.
